Output 81e12991de9ba393fd93740f1011975edc45d5eea163159cf1c07ff31abd2c21:0

value
36225403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f44cafba8c0978002a7a3afe4183916405b0ad0 OP_EQUAL
address
MJ3VeYABCNXmEEZqjXj4NsB8ranZwQvgWQ
transaction
81e12991de9ba393fd93740f1011975edc45d5eea163159cf1c07ff31abd2c21
spent
true